dns-server <address> <secondary>

Use the dns-server command to specify the de fault primary and secondary Domain Name System (DNS)
servers to use for the Dynamic Host Configuration Protoco l (DHCP) client. Use the no form of this
command to remove the configured DNS server.
Syntax Description
<address> Specifies the address (in dotted decimal notation) of the preferred DNS server on
the network (example: 192.72.4.254).
<secondary> Optional. Specifies the address (in dotted decimal notation) of the second
preferred DNS server on the network (example: 192.100.4.253).
Default Values
By default, there are no specified default DNS servers.
Applicable Platforms
This command applies to the NetVanta 300, 1000, 1000R, 2000, 3000, 4000, and 5000 and
Total Access 900 Series units.
Command History
Release 2.1 Command was introduced.
Usage Examples
The following example specifies a default DNS serv er with address 192.72.3.254 and a secondary DNS
server with address 192.100.4.253:
(config)#ip dhcp-server pool MyPool
(config-dhcp)#dns-server 192.72.3.254 192.100.4.253
